High Court Upholds INEC’s Decision on Mpina Case

The hopes of opposition politician Luhaga Mpina to contest in Tanzania’s upcoming presidential election have been dashed after the High Court of Tanzania dismissed his petition challenging the decision of the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) to disqualify him from the race.
